We are seeking a highly motivated individual with interest in semiconductor process and device development to work with our Technology Development team in advancing world class differentiated semiconductor technologies for our 200mm manufacturing fabricator in Vermont (FAB9). New hires will immediately embed within our project teams of process, integration, and device engineers in developing new process flows in CMOS, SiGe, and GaN technologies, targeting new and improved RF applications.
